Festive car boot sale at the Pialevialle stadium in Recharinges, with tripe and local food
Every last Sunday of June, the association Les Amis de l'Auze organizes its car boot sale at the Pialevialle football stadium, in the hamlet of Recharinges, in the commune of Araules (43200). The day starts at 7 am with the tripe service (€8), an emblematic dish of Auvergne tradition, and continues with a charcuterie-cheese meal at noon (€10). An authentic rural event combining treasure hunting and local gastronomy.
Araules, a village perched in the Sucs of Haute-Loire between fir forests and volcanic plateaus, comes alive every last Sunday of June thanks to the car boot sale organized by the association Les Amis de l'Auze. This annual event, rooted in Auvergne rural tradition, is held at the Pialevialle football stadium, in the hamlet of Recharinges, a few kilometers from the village of Araules.
The Pialevialle stadium, in the locality of Recharinges, offers a green and typical setting of the Haute-Loire high plateaus. Surrounded by meadows and forests, this rural site hosts the car boot sale in a relaxed and authentic atmosphere. Signposts on the D15 between Le Puy-en-Velay and Valence allow visitors to easily find their way.
One of the specificities of this car boot sale lies in its Auvergne-inspired gastronomic offer. From 7 am, the volunteers of Les Amis de l'Auze serve tripe for €8, an emblematic dish of Haute-Loire peasant cuisine. This morning service is highly appreciated by exhibitors and early visitors who wish to start the day in the best conditions. At noon, a charcuterie and cheese meal is offered for €10, allowing you to fully enjoy the day on site.
L'Auze is a river that flows through the plateau communes around Araules. The association Les Amis de l'Auze unites the inhabitants of the area around cultural, sporting, and festive projects. This car boot sale is one of its flagship events, allowing both the local community to gather and visitors from the region to be attracted. The organization is entirely voluntary, and the resulting atmosphere is resolutely warm and friendly.
For flea market enthusiasts seeking a change of scenery, the Recharinges car boot sale offers a unique experience: treasure hunting at altitude, in a preserved natural setting, with the Auvergne accent and the aromas of local cuisine. Exhibitors generally offer typical items from country attics: old tools, rural tableware, peasant furniture, old books, and trinkets of all kinds.
